Survivor: Baumholder

Last summer, God put on my heart the desire to have a support group for wives with deployed soldiers. Little did I know, that He would ask me to run it. With the help of 2 other ladies, we started in December before our husbands deployed, with an attendance of 10 ladies. We are up to 26, and the ladies are still coming. When you walk into the room during a meeting, you can tell that God has hand picked each and everyone to be there. They are beautiful, smart, tired, strong, funny, lonely, and ever changing women. We pray, celebrate birthday & anniversaries, play games, and talk about the "stuff" that we are going through during this 15 month long deployment. I am humbled and honored to be amongst these ladies. God, you are so good! I will keep you posted.

America the Beautiful!



Today our family went to the casing of the colors. Each unit has their own flag. In this ceremony the deploying units will display their flag and then inclose it in a case. The flag will stay inclosed until each unit comes home. It is very emotional for the families but a great tradition to be apart of. We can't wait for our soldier to come home!
